Transaction 1db6f027ec34353d2e77e220bbbb794ca065c5819ce001a20f4cc88fcdfec209
1 Input
1 Outputs
- 1db6f027ec34353d2e77e220bbbb794ca065c5819ce001a20f4cc88fcdfec209:0
value 1141276
address 1NHZd76dkTGhKSHqW9DSZjEEDj7uEVGo3e